"Si un trabajador quiere hacer bien su trabajo, primero debe afilar sus herramientas." - Confucio, "Las Analectas de Confucio. Lu Linggong"
Página delantera > Programación > ¿Cómo puede el encadenamiento de métodos mejorar la manipulación del código Java?

¿Cómo puede el encadenamiento de métodos mejorar la manipulación del código Java?

Publicado el 2024-12-22
Navegar:523

How Can Method Chaining Enhance Java Code Manipulation?

Encadenamiento de métodos en Java: lograr fluidez en la manipulación de código

Para lograr el encadenamiento de métodos en Java, modifique las firmas de sus métodos para devolver el "this " objeto. Esto permite un encadenamiento fluido de llamadas a métodos, como se muestra a continuación:

public Dialog setMessage(String message) {
    // Message setting logic
    return this;
}

Casos de uso de encadenamiento de métodos

El encadenamiento de métodos es particularmente útil cuando tiene una serie de acciones que desea realizar en un objeto. Reduce la repetición de código y simplifica la manipulación de objetos, como se ve en este ejemplo:

// Traditional approach
Dialog dialog = new Dialog();
dialog.setMessage("Message");
Último tutorial Más>

Descargo de responsabilidad: Todos los recursos proporcionados provienen en parte de Internet. Si existe alguna infracción de sus derechos de autor u otros derechos e intereses, explique los motivos detallados y proporcione pruebas de los derechos de autor o derechos e intereses y luego envíelos al correo electrónico: [email protected]. Lo manejaremos por usted lo antes posible.

Copyright© 2022 湘ICP备2022001581号-3